Today we visit Salem NC. Salem was founded in 1766 by the Moravians a Protestant faith that began in what is now known as the Czech Republic. The Moravians were missionaries who established an earlier settlement in Bethlehem. The architecture and landscape of Salem are still quite accurate, as many of the Historic Town buildings are original structures.

At Winkler Bakery my friend and I get a cookie big enough to share, but we get one each from this bakery.The dome bake oven at Winkler is typical of bake ovens used in Salem. The Bakery's oven is still heated with wood as it was nearly 200 years ago. Pretty damn good chocolate chip cookie.

Live oak trees with spanish moss
Spanish moss - airplants - member of the pineapple family. You can only see it here in the South. The plant is not parasitic, it can sometimes damage the host tree by over-shading the leaves, thus reducing photosynthesis, or by weighing down and breaking the branches. Other than that it´s harmless for the tree. I think it gives the tree a romantic ghostly aura.
